اشتراک‌ها
ارسال یک Dictionary به یک ASP.NET MVC Action
  <p>
    <input type="text" name="Model.Values[@first].Key" value="@kvp.Key" />
    <input type="text" name="Model.Values[@first].Value" value="@kvp.Value" />
    <input type="hidden" name="Model.Values.Index" value="@first" />
  </p>
ارسال یک Dictionary به یک ASP.NET MVC Action
اشتراک‌ها
weakmap ها در ES6
essentially Weakmaps are a collection of keys and values with the main constraint being the key has to be an object. 
weakmap ها در ES6
نظرات مطالب
ASP.NET MVC #17
یک نکته تکمیلی: در صورتی که با کلمه کلیدی Request بخواهید پارامترها را بخوانید و در کلاسی مانند فیلترها قرار گرفته باشید استفاده از ValidateInput روی فیلترها کارآمد نخواهد بود. جهت غیرفعال کردن این ویژگی در این مواقع می‌توانید از کد زیر استفاده کنید:
filterContext.HttpContext.Request.Unvalidated[key]
Request شامل خصوصیت Unvalidated است که باعث خاموش شدن اعتبارسنجی بر روی فیلد مورد نظر می‌شود.
نظرات مطالب
ارتقاء به ASP.NET Core 1.0 - قسمت 8 - فعال سازی ASP.NET MVC
با سلام. بعد از فعال کردن mvc ، خطای زیر همواره دریافت می‌شود:
 Error while building type Microsoft.AspNetCore.Routing.DefaultInlineConstraintResolver
با این پیغام برای inner exception:
 An item with the same key has already been added 
محتوای startup هم به این صورت است:
startup.txt
نظرات مطالب
خلاصه‌ای در مورد SQL Server CE
اینطور که گفتین خود سایت هم داره از این دیتابیس بهره میبره
الان شما برای Primary key گفتین توسط EF پشتیبانی نمیشه چه راهکاری انتخاب کردید؟

نهایت حجمی که دیتابیس پشتیبانی میکنه چقدره؟ الان خود این سایت چقدر شده اگه گفتنش امکان داره؟
نظرات مطالب
افزونه farsiInput جهت ورودی فقط فارسی در صفحات وب
در متدهای keydown و keypress فوق، اگر متد ()e.preventDefault فراخوانی شود، دکمه‌ی فشرده شده نمایش داده نخواهد شد. در همینجا باز‌ه‌ی key دریافتی را بررسی کنید. مثلا 97 مساوی a است تا 122 که z است. اگر خارج از آن بود متد ()e.preventDefault را فراخوانی کنید.
نظرات مطالب
نرمال سازی (قسمت دوم: Second Normal Form)
بله همینطوره.
سایت ویکی توضیحات خوبی راجب معایب و مزایای استفاده از surrogate key داده.
یه مرور بسیار جزئی که به معایب و مزایا داشتم متوجه شدم که در پست قبلیم از معایبش به normalization و از مزایاش به performance اش اشاره ای داشتم.

نظرات مطالب
NOSQL قسمت سوم
سلام تشکر از مطلب بسیار مفیدتون .
می خواستم بدونم که کدام یک از روش‌ها بیشتر امتحان خودش رو توی داده‌های زیاد پس داده .و بشه راحتر باهاش کار کرد .
روش 
Document store
Key value
روش هایی دیگری رو هم توی سایت دیدم اگر امکان داره مزایا و معایب هر کدوم رو توضیح دهید ممنون.
نظرات مطالب
EF Code First #7
قبل از ویرایش این سطر را اضافه کنید
if(user.Roles != null && user.Roles.Any())
   user.Roles.Clear();
همچنین اگر itemهای دریافتی primary key هستند می‌تونید از متد attach بجای مراجعه به بانک اطلاعاتی، استفاده کنید:
ctx.Roles.Attach(new Role { Id = item });